Various Techniques for Controlling Transmit Power in Cognitive Radio: A Survey

Cognitive radio has been recently proposed as a promising technology to improve the spectrum utilization efficiency by intelligently sensing and accessing some vacant bands of primary users (PU). After reviewing fundamental papers it is found that much work has been done in the field of spectrum sensing for cognitive radio and different types of spectrum sensing methods. Transmitted power of CUs causes interference to PU when it is beyond tolerance limit. Most of this area has been remained untouched. This paper focuses on the work done in controlling the transmit power. In this situation, an effective and appropriate power control method is necessary for cognitive users for achieving quality of service (QoS).
